LABORATORY ASST - Pletcher
The University of Michigan is seeking an energetic and reliable individual to work in a laboratory studying genetic aspects of aging using Drosophila melanogaster. The role involves preparing and distributing fly food in a laboratory setting for 10-20 hours per week.

Responsibilities
Cooking fly food, an agar-based sugar and yeast mix, in a small kitchen set up with cooking kettles
Distributing the food into vials
